Description
The door is painted a solid blue color and is comprised of two vertical panels below a series of twelve rectangular glass panes arranged in a three-by-four grid at the top. A dark-colored doormat lies at the threshold. A bronze-colored door knocker is mounted centrally near the top of the door. A bronze-colored door handle and lock mechanism is located on the left side of the door. The door is framed by a light brown wooden trim. Flanking the door are narrow vertical glass panes on either side, also framed in the same light brown wood. The exterior wall to the left of the door is constructed of rough-cut stones in varying shades of gray and brown. The wall to the right of the door is covered in brown wood shingles above a section of stonework. Two large, ornate gray stone pots containing ferns are positioned on either side of the door on a slate tile surface. Hydrangeas are planted around the base of each pot.
